I've done it on a 71 K10. I used the method from Glock35ispc and it worked great! The problem with 73-87 is the frame dips just in front of the rear cab mounts. You might have enough room between the spring hanger and the cab mount to chop the 12". Around here, there is not much demand for swb frames so I cut them up.
